What is BMI?

The BMI formula calculates a numerical value representing the relationship between a person's weight and height. It is expressed as weight (kilograms) divided by height (meters squared). While a useful screening tool, its application in individual cases should be viewed judiciously. Classifying Weight Status:

The BMI table for adults typically delineates weight categories based on the following benchmarks:

  • Underweight: A BMI below 18.5 indicates an underweight status. This often stems from dietary deficiencies, increased metabolism, or other health conditions. This status necessitates professional medical attention to ascertain the root causes. Underweight individuals may experience various health concerns.
  • Normal Weight: A BMI between 18.5 and 24.9 falls squarely within the "healthy weight" spectrum. Maintaining this range generally correlates with a reduced risk of several chronic health complications. This status is generally viewed as optimal for overall health.
  • Overweight: A BMI of 25.0 to 29.9 signifies an overweight status. This frequently necessitates a reassessment of dietary habits and an increased emphasis on physical activity. Lifestyle modifications are essential to mitigate associated health risks.
  • Obese: A BMI exceeding 30.0 indicates obesity, a condition correlated with heightened risks of chronic diseases. This classification underscores the urgency of seeking professional guidance to implement effective weight management strategies.

Limitations of BMI

It's crucial to recognize the inherent limitations of the BMI formula. For example, individuals with a high muscle mass might fall into the overweight category despite possessing a healthy physique. Furthermore, an athlete or individual with high muscle density may also fall into this category. Similarly, elderly individuals may exhibit a lower BMI due to decreased muscle mass, yet they may still have optimal health. Consequently, relying solely on BMI for assessment can prove misleading. Other factors like waist circumference, body composition, and medical history need to be considered for a more comprehensive evaluation. This necessitates a holistic approach to health assessment.
